Troubleshooting Charter Internet Issues

Power Cycling Your Equipment

One of the simplest troubleshooting steps you can take is to power cycle your modem and router. To do this, unplug both devices from the power outlet and wait for 30 seconds before plugging them back in.

Checking Cable Connections

Loose or damaged cables can also cause internet outages. Inspect the cables connecting your modem, router, and computer for any signs of damage or looseness.

Disabling the Firewall

In rare cases, your firewall may be interfering with your internet connection. Try temporarily disabling your firewall and checking if your internet starts working.

Table: Charter Internet Outage Causes and Troubleshooting

Possible Cause Troubleshooting Steps
Network outage Check the Charter outage map or contact customer service.
Loose or damaged cables Inspect and tighten any loose cables.
Firewall interference Temporarily disable the firewall on your computer.
Power outage Check if other electrical devices in your home are working.
Modem or router failure Power cycle the devices or contact Charter for assistance.

What are some reasons for Charter Internet outages?

Outages can be caused by weather, power outages, equipment failures, or line damage.

How can I avoid Charter Internet outages?

Secure your outdoor equipment, such as lines and cables, to protect them from weather damage. Use surge protectors to prevent damage from power surges.
